Area contextNeighborhood Overview – Willow Valley School (Gordon, NE)
Gordon, Nebraska, is a small but friendly community located in Sheridan County, in the northwestern part of the state. Willow Valley School sits on the eastern edge of the town, easily accessible from U.S. Route 19, which runs north-south through Gordon. This route connects to U.S. Route 20, a major east-west highway, providing access to the wider region. For those traveling by air, Scottsbluff County Airport (BFF) is the closest significant airport, located about 75 miles south. Drive times from Scottsbluff typically range from 1.5 to 2 hours depending on traffic and road conditions. Driving into Gordon via US-19 offers straightforward access to the school. Parking is generally available directly at the school, but for larger district events, utilizing the streets surrounding the campus or designated overflow areas may be necessary. Consider arriving at least 30-45 minutes prior to scheduled events to secure preferred parking and avoid any last-minute congestion, especially during peak times or popular community gatherings held at the school facilities.

Downtown Gordon · 1.2 miBeyond the Event: Beyond the immediate town of Gordon, opportunities for exploration include scenic drives through the Nebraska Sandhills, a vast grassland region known for its unique ecosystem and rolling terrain. Further afield, larger towns like Chadron offer additional historical sites, including the Museum of the Fur Trade, and more diverse dining options. For outdoor enthusiasts, the Pine Ridge Ranger District of the Nebraska National Forest, located north of Gordon, provides hiking trails and natural beauty.

Weather & Seasons at Willow Valley School
- Winter: Expect cold temperatures with average highs in the 30s Fahrenheit and lows often below freezing. Snowfall is common, which can make driving conditions slick and require extra time for travel. Dress in warm layers, including hats, gloves, and insulated footwear for any outdoor activities or waiting between events. Indoor venues are your best bet for staying warm and comfortable.
- Spring & early summer: Temperatures begin to warm up significantly, typically ranging from the 50s to 70s Fahrenheit. This is a pleasant time for outdoor activities, but rain showers are also frequent. Lightweight layers are recommended, along with a rain jacket. Be prepared for variable conditions, from sunny days to cooler, wet spells, which can influence game schedules and outdoor comfort.
- Mid-summer: Summer days can become quite hot, with highs often in the 80s and 90s Fahrenheit. Sun protection, such as sunscreen, hats, and sunglasses, is essential for anyone spending time outdoors. Staying hydrated is crucial; carry water bottles. While mornings and evenings are usually more comfortable, midday heat can be intense, making shaded areas or indoor activities preferable.
- Fall season: Autumn brings cooler, crisp air, with temperatures generally ranging from the 50s to 70s Fahrenheit, gradually dropping into the 40s. Fall is often considered a beautiful time to visit, with potential for pleasant outdoor conditions for sports. Layers are key for adapting to changing temperatures throughout the day. A light jacket or sweater is usually sufficient for comfortable outdoor enjoyment.
- Rain & snow: Both rain and snow are common throughout the year, particularly in spring and fall for rain, and winter for snow. Be sure to check the weather forecast immediately before your trip and daily. Pack appropriate gear such as waterproof jackets and umbrellas for rain, and sturdy, water-resistant boots for snowy conditions. These weather events can sometimes lead to delays or cancellations, so having flexibility in your schedule is advisable.
